If you’re looking for a chilled out place to relax for a few days or weeks, look no further than Tulum. The town is located a couple of kilometres from the beach, but you can easily catch a colectivo or hire a bike and ride over to it. The beach itself is exactly what you would expect from a tropical paradise: palm trees, white sand beach, turquoise water.
And to top it off, there are Mayan ruins on a headland overlooking the beach. In fact, there’s beach access inside the ruins. It’s a perfect way to cool off after exploring the ancient Mayan city.
Tulum is located about 2 hours south of Cancun and 1 hour south of Playa del Carmen. The main highway passes right through the middle of town.
